Preguntas con etiqueta 'avr'

10
respuestas

SPI o I2C: que usar para un bus largo

Estoy contemplando un proyecto que requiera que varios AVR se comuniquen entre sí a través de un autobús. Estarían separados por hasta 6 pies. Parece que tanto I2C como SPI pueden permitir que una serie de micros se comuniquen a través de un...
4
respuestas

¿Quién recibe el valor devuelto por main ()?

Sé que en las computadoras, el sistema operativo recibe el valor devuelto por la función main() . Pero, ¿qué sucede en la función main() de un microcontrolador?     
1
respuesta

¿Por qué se restablece mi AVR cuando llamo a wdt_disable () para intentar apagar el temporizador de vigilancia?

Tengo un problema al ejecutar una secuencia de vigilancia deshabilitada en un AVR ATtiny84A en realidad está restableciendo el chip incluso aunque el temporizador debería tener un montón de tiempo en él. Esto sucede de manera inconsistente y c...
5
respuestas

¿Cómo pueden los dispositivos como el Game Boy Advance alcanzar su velocidad de fotogramas?

He estado diseñando mi propio dispositivo de juego portátil basado en un microcontrolador AVR y una pequeña pantalla OLED. Comencé con una pantalla monocromática de 128x64 píxeles y puedo dibujarla cómodamente a más de 60 cuadros por segundo....
17
respuestas

¿Completar alternativas al IDE de Arduino? [cerrado]

No soy tan fanático del IDE oficial de Arduino (en términos visuales), así que empecé a buscar alternativas más agradables. Sin embargo, la mayoría de los proyectos que he encontrado están en alpha / beta y generalmente están incompletos. Soy...
6
respuestas

¿Por qué los AVR de Atmel son tan populares?

Una pregunta reciente sobre las ventajas / desventajas de varios tipos de MCU. Las AVR no parecían siquiera merecer una mención dadas las respuestas. ¿Por qué, entonces, a un extraño le parece que los AVR están experimentando una oleada de popul...
2
respuestas

¿Qué es bit banging

Soy nuevo en la programación de microcontroladores. Estoy usando el controlador ATmega32-A y el compilador CodeVisionAVR. Estoy utilizando el generador de forma de onda (AD9833) para generar una señal de onda sinusoidal mediante la comunicación...
5
respuestas

ATMega8: ¿por qué deben conectarse VCC y AVCC?

A menudo leo que es una buena práctica conectar VCC con AVCC. Incluso en la hoja de datos de ATMega8 lo dice así:    AVCC es el pin de voltaje de alimentación para el convertidor A / D, puerto C (3..0),   y ADC (7..6). Debe estar conectado ex...
8
respuestas

¿Sugerencias para un conector pequeño y práctico para la programación en el circuito?

Tengo muchos PCB que usan un AVR en el empaque SMD, y como frecuentemente cambio el firmware en las placas prototipo, estoy tratando de encontrar la mejor solución para programar el AVR de manera rápida y sencilla. El primer enfoque fue tener...
3
respuestas

¿Qué son los fusibles Atmel?

¿Qué son los fusibles en los microprocesadores Atmel y cuándo debo o debo cambiar la configuración predeterminada?